Berets are very simple to sculpt, laughably so, in fact. I would go so far to say that <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(69);'>IG</span> berets are probably one of the best starting sculpts to do, for those with little experience.<br /> <br /> Here is the simple breakdown that I have used:<br /> <br /> Use <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(69);'>IG</span> Catachan heads, plastic preferably. Cut off the top of their heads and/or trim away their hair/bandannas to where the brim of the beret will be and so that their heads will conform to the beret. Leave a small lip from their bandannas as a guide and as the "curl" of the edge of the beret.<br /> <br /> Next, use Green Stuff to form a pointed "dunce" cap atop the head, leaning to the opposite side you want your beret, make enough length to stretch over to the other side.<br /> <br /> Trim or shape the point into a semi-circle and then fold over. <br /> <br /> Use a craft razor to adjust the beret as necessary, be sure to smooth the Green Stuff with the razor after a few minutes of hardening. You may have to practice this many times before you get good berets, but if you are doing a lot of them, then you will be able to stand a handful of less convincing berets (which is reasonable, you see a lot of bad berets in the military). <br /> <br /> But if you want to spend money for a ton of heads that look the same..... ]]></description>

				<description><![CDATA[ @ CommissarCandlestick : That would be a problem, but you probably will not have trouble finding Catachan heads from other players or cheap online (ebay or bitz retailers). Cadian Screaming Sergeants should also work.<br /> <br /> @ TheGiantPeanut : Are they proper scale? I have seen these before, but only the advertisements and not on model. Straight 28mm scale is very different from <span class="glossaryitem" onmouseover='gp(3);'>40k</span> "28mm hero" scale, so "normal" sized heads may look funny on Cadians. Just a thought.]]></description>
